It opened up on 21 February 1828, and today is a oral museum. The first dental college, Baltimore College of Oral Surgery, opened up in Baltimore, Maryland, US in 1840. The second in the United States was the Ohio College of Dental Surgery, established in Cincinnati, Ohio, in 1845. The Philadelphia College of Dental Surgery followed in 1852.

The British Dentists Act of 1878 and the 1879 Dental professionals Register restricted the title of "dental professional" and "oral doctor" to qualified and registered experts. Nevertheless, others can legitimately explain themselves as "oral professionals" or "dental specialists". The practice of dentistry in the UK came to be fully regulated with the 1921 Dental practitioners Act, which required the registration of any individual practicing dental care.

Dental practitioners in the UK are currently managed by the General Dental Council. In numerous countries, dental professionals normally total in between 5 and 8 years of post-secondary education and learning prior to practicing. Not compulsory, several dental professionals choose to complete an internship or residency concentrating on details facets of oral treatment after they have received their dental level.

All dental professionals in the United States go through a minimum of 3 years of undergraduate research studies, but nearly all finish a bachelor's degree. This education is complied with by four years of dental institution to certify as a "Medical Professional of Dental Surgical Treatment" (DDS) or "Doctor of Oral Medication" (DMD).
